### Step 4: Migrate the Audit-Log Viewer

The legacy viewer in Coppervane read events directly from the primary database. The replacement, Ledgerglass, consumes the event stream instead, so historical entries must be backfilled before cutover. Run the backfill job once per region and confirm row counts match within 0.1%. Do not decommission the old viewer until two weeks of parallel operation have passed. Ledgerglass reads its runtime settings from the values listed below.

deployment values, yahag-tawef:
ZORWYN_HOST=zorwyn.tolvaqlabs.internal
ZORWYN_PORT=9300

## Tuning

The Quillbatch renderer balances rasterization speed against memory use when generating PDF invoices. Support staff handling slow-render tickets should first check whether the customer's template exceeds the default page complexity budget. Raising the glyph cache helps with dense line-item tables, but watch heap usage on shared workers. Changes take effect after a worker restart; always test against the Fernmont sample invoice pack first. The defaults shipped with release 4.2 are below.

limits module of fajog-tawig:
RATE_LIMITS = {
    "druwyn": 2,
    "quenael": 10,
    "wenix": 2,
    "druael": 2,
}

**Q: I'm visiting the Threnby data centre to work in a client cage — how do I get in?**

A: Easy enough. Check in at the security desk with photo ID and your work order, and you'll be escorted to the cage floor. You can't roam unaccompanied, sorry. Your escort will open the cage corridor using the access code below.

turnstile pass: bdg-NZJSS-18109